PDF - Edit - Save? How to do it?


Recommended Posts

I want to take a PDF file and make it so the kids can type answers into the correct spaces then save it. We will be going full time in an RV for 5 years or more. I need to save space and weight, so I would love it if I didn't have to print everything out, or take books for every subject. HELP !! I know there has to be a way. 

They have Chromebooks and I am on a PC.

We used an app for that on our ipads called Notability.  I could load the pdfs, he wrote/typed on them, and sent them back to me.  Or he could attach blank sheets (or graph paper) for math tests to show his work.  I bet there's something like that for Chromebooks.

In Google Drive I open the doc with DocHub and then I can edit and save.
